Skip to content

Conversation

@denialhaag
Copy link
Member

Description

This PR improves the title of Renovate PRs that apply patch updates. Currently, these PRs use ⬆️🪝, also when the PRs include a mix of pre-commit and GitHub Actions updates (see, for example, munich-quantum-toolkit/qmap#887). This PR changes the emojis to ⬆️🩹.

Checklist:

  • The pull request only contains commits that are focused and relevant to this change.
  • I have added appropriate tests that cover the new/changed functionality.
  • I have updated the documentation to reflect these changes.
  • I have added entries to the changelog for any noteworthy additions, changes, fixes, or removals.
  • I have added migration instructions to the upgrade guide (if needed).
  • The changes follow the project's style guidelines and introduce no new warnings.
  • The changes are fully tested and pass the CI checks.
  • I have reviewed my own code changes.

@denialhaag denialhaag requested a review from burgholzer January 12, 2026 18:24
@denialhaag denialhaag self-assigned this Jan 12, 2026
@denialhaag denialhaag added the fix Fixes something that is not working label Jan 12, 2026
@denialhaag denialhaag force-pushed the improve-renovate-emoji branch from f672507 to 86933ec Compare January 12, 2026 18:25
@coderabbitai
Copy link
Contributor

coderabbitai bot commented Jan 12, 2026

📝 Walkthrough

Summary by CodeRabbit

  • Chores
    • Updated commit message prefix for automated dependency update commits with new emoji notation.

✏️ Tip: You can customize this high-level summary in your review settings.

Walkthrough

A single line was added to the Renovate configuration file, introducing a new commitMessagePrefix field with the emoji sequence "⬆️💙" for the patch versions update group. No other fields or groups were modified.

Changes

Cohort / File(s) Summary
Renovate Configuration
templates/renovate.json5
Added commitMessagePrefix: "⬆️💙" to the patch-updates package rules group for customized commit message prefixes

Estimated code review effort

🎯 1 (Trivial) | ⏱️ ~2 minutes

Possibly related PRs

Suggested labels

dependencies, usability

Poem

🐰 Emojis dance in commit lines bright,
A blue heart with an upward flight,
Patch versions now have style to show,
Through renovate's config flow! ⬆️💙

🚥 Pre-merge checks | ✅ 3
✅ Passed checks (3 passed)
Check name Status Explanation
Title check ✅ Passed The title clearly summarizes the main change: improving emojis for patch updates in Renovate configuration.
Description check ✅ Passed The description covers the main change and motivation, though non-critical sections like tests, documentation, and changelog are marked as not applicable.
Docstring Coverage ✅ Passed No functions found in the changed files to evaluate docstring coverage. Skipping docstring coverage check.

✏️ Tip: You can configure your own custom pre-merge checks in the settings.


📜 Recent review details

Configuration used: Organization UI

Review profile: ASSERTIVE

Plan: Pro

📥 Commits

Reviewing files that changed from the base of the PR and between 52cb813 and 8a0e2a1.

📒 Files selected for processing (1)
  • templates/renovate.json5
🔇 Additional comments (1)
templates/renovate.json5 (1)

53-60: AI summary inconsistency: emoji rendered incorrectly.

The AI summary shows "⬆️💙" but the actual Unicode sequence \uD83E\uDE79 decodes to 🩹 (adhesive bandage), which correctly matches the PR objective of changing to ⬆️🩹.

The change is correct and semantically appropriate—the bandage emoji nicely represents "patch" updates.


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out.

❤️ Share

Comment @coderabbitai help to get the list of available commands and usage tips.

Copy link
Member

@burgholzer burgholzer left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nice. Technically only one of the updates here was necessary, right? the other one would have come with the templates update.

@denialhaag
Copy link
Member Author

Nice. Technically only one of the updates here was necessary, right? the other one would have come with the templates update.

You are right; I have reverted the change to the Renovate config itself now. 😌

@denialhaag denialhaag merged commit 88a0d84 into main Jan 12, 2026
10 checks passed
@denialhaag denialhaag deleted the improve-renovate-emoji branch January 12, 2026 22:03
@coderabbitai coderabbitai bot mentioned this pull request Jan 13, 2026
8 tasks
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

fix Fixes something that is not working

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ants